// skipGNUTests generates a string for skipping specific tests by number in a
|
||||
// GNU test suite. This is nontrivial because the test suite does not support
|
||||
// excluding tests in any way, so ranges for all but the skipped tests have to
|
||||
// be specified instead.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// For example, to skip test 764, ranges around the skipped test must be
|
||||
// specified:
|
||||
//
|
||||
// 1-763 765-
|
||||
//
|
||||
// Tests are numbered starting from 1. The resulting string is unquoted.
|
||||
func skipGNUTests(tests ...int) string {
|
||||
tests = slices.Clone(tests)
|
||||
slices.Sort(tests)
|
||||
|
||||
var buf strings.Builder
|
||||
|
||||
if tests[0] != 1 {
|
||||
buf.WriteString("1-")
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
for i, n := range tests {
|
||||
if n != 1 && (i == 0 || tests[i-1] != n-1) {
|
||||
buf.WriteString(strconv.Itoa(n - 1))
|
||||
buf.WriteString(" ")
|
||||
}
|
||||
if i == len(tests)-1 || tests[i+1] != n+1 {
|
||||
buf.WriteString(strconv.Itoa(n + 1))
|
||||
buf.WriteString("-")
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
return buf.String()
|
||||
}
